Bank and payment fraud involves unauthorized access to your financial accounts to initiate wire transfers, ACH payments, or credit card transactions. It also includes business email compromise (BEC) scams where fraudsters trick employees into wiring corporate funds to fake accounts.

Correspondent banks act as intermediaries between the sending and receiving banks, especially in international wire transfers. They are crucial because they hold the clearing accounts where funds briefly rest. By analyzing these clearing accounts, we can often halt a transaction before it reaches the scammer.
